MAN WHO SAW PHILADELPHIA ABDUCTION AND ALERTED POLICE IS CALLED A HERO (STA BREAKING NEWS and ARCHIVES)

by STANews @, Friday, November 07, 2014, 13:01

(CNN) -- Two people yell and struggle on a city street. It happens every day.

And when it does, what do you do?

Dwayne Fletcher found himself thrust into this position around 9:40 p.m. Sunday, as he was walking in Philadelphia's Germantown-Penn Knox neighborhood. He saw a man seemingly manhandling a woman, then forcing her into a car. Fletcher said he yelled out and called police.

The car sped away. But three days later, the two -- Carlesha Freeland-Gaither and the man police say abducted her, Delvin Barnes -- were tracked down 115 miles southwest in Jessup, Maryland.
